How they compare

Viet Nam currently reports 65.36 1000 ha against 7.72 1000 ha in Republic of Moldova, a difference of 57.64 1000 ha.

That makes Viet Nam's figure about 8.5 times Republic of Moldova's.

Across all 31 years both countries report, Viet Nam has been ahead every year.

Republic of Moldova ranks 12th and Viet Nam ranks 10th of 20 countries.

Viet Nam has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Land Cover data under the Agri-Environmental Indicators section contains land cover information organized by the land cover classes of the international standard system for Environmental and Economic Accounting Central Framework (SEEA CF). The land cover information is compiled from publicly available Global Land Cover (GLC) maps: a) MODIS land cover types based on the Land Cover Classification System, LCCS; b) The European Spatial Agency (ESA) Climate Change Initiative (CCI) annual land cover maps produced by the Université catholique de Louvain (UCL)-Geomatics and now under the European Copernicus Program; c) The annual land cover maps which were produced under the European Copernicus Global Land Service (CGLS) (CGLS land cover, containing discrete land cover categorization), with spatial resolution 100m; and d) the WorldCover maps of the European Space Agency, produced at 10m resolution.
